Constructed in 1930, the Residences at Carlyle Hotel stand as a paragon of luxury and history in the prestigious Upper East Side neighborhood. With its 40 stories, this iconic building has been a beacon of high society, hosting royalty, diplomats, and celebrities. The 51 exclusive units within the Carlyle offer a blend of classic charm and modern sophistication, reflecting nearly a century of New York City's evolution.

About Residences at Carlyle Hotel
The Residences at Carlyle Hotel feature a collection of units that cater to a range of preferences, from the coziest 1,213-square-foot two-bedroom homes to the palatial 3,400-square-foot four-bedroom residences. Each space within the Carlyle is meticulously crafted, boasting high-beamed ceilings, hardwood flooring, and large windows that invite an abundance of natural light. The residences' thoughtful layouts are complemented by Poggenpohl custom kitchens equipped with Miele appliances and granite countertops, while the tranquil bathrooms offer a spa-like atmosphere, ensuring a private retreat from the city's bustle.
The Carlyle is not just a residence but a lifestyle, offering an array of amenities and services that exemplify the pinnacle of luxury living. Residents enjoy the convenience of bi-daily housekeeping, a responsive concierge team, and vigilant doormen ensuring privacy and security. The building's fitness center is a state-of-the-art facility, and the Spa Valmont and Yves Durif Salon provide residents with a sanctuary for wellness and beauty. Culinary experiences are redefined with options like in-room dining, the famed Cafe Carlyle, Bemelmans Bar, and Dowling's at The Carlyle, along with private catering possibilities in the hotel's banquet facilities.
Nestled in the Upper East Side, the Carlyle is surrounded by a tapestry of cultural landmarks and verdant escapes. Steps away from Central Park, residents can easily transition from the urban landscape to lush greenery. The neighborhood is a treasure trove of art with globally renowned museums such as The Metropolitan, the Guggenheim, and the Frick Collection. For the sartorially inclined, Madison Avenue presents a selection of designer boutiques, while a variety of fine dining establishments and top restaurants offer exquisite culinary adventures.
The Carlyle's location in the Upper East Side ensures that residents are never far from the pulse of the city. With proximity to major transit stations like the 68 Street-Hunter College and 77 Street (4,6 Line) subway stations, navigating New York City becomes effortless. Bus stations such as MADISON AV/E 74 ST and 5 AV/E 75 ST provide additional options for public transportation. For travel further afield, airports including John F. Kennedy International, Newark Liberty International, and LaGuardia are within a convenient driving distance, connecting residents to the world.
